Downloading form https tarball is faster than clonig a git repo.
BR2_LINUX_KERNEL_CUSTOM_GIT can be used as a fallback mechanism
to downlad the CIP kernel with git.

I've applied both patches to next, thanks. However, you had apparently
based those patches on master, while they should have been based on
next (they are improvements/version bumps). And also, the commit title
should have mention that the change is related to the CIP kernel.
Indeed "linux: change download method" is a bit vague as it doesn't say
that it changes the download method for the CIP kernel. Ditto for the
second patch. I tweaked the commit titles when applying.
